What is the GNDU 5-Year Integrated M.Tech (FYIP) Program?

The GNDU 5-Year Integrated M.Tech (FYIP) program is a meticulously designed academic offering that combines the undergraduate (B.Tech) and postgraduate (M.Tech) degrees into a single, cohesive curriculum spanning five years. This integrated approach provides students with a seamless transition from fundamental engineering concepts to advanced specialization within their chosen field. Unlike the traditional route of pursuing a B.Tech degree followed by a separate M.Tech program, the FYIP program eliminates the need for a break in studies and allows students to delve deeper into their area of interest sooner. The program's structure is carefully crafted to ensure a strong foundation in core engineering principles during the initial years, followed by specialized coursework and research opportunities in the later stages. This integrated nature not only saves students a year of academic pursuit but also fosters a more holistic understanding of the subject matter. Comparing GNDU FYIP with Other Options

When considering the GNDU 5-Year Integrated M.Tech (FYIP) program, it is essential to compare it with other available options to make an informed decision. The most common alternative is the traditional route of pursuing a B.Tech degree followed by a separate M.Tech program. While both options lead to a postgraduate degree, there are significant differences in terms of duration, curriculum, and overall learning experience. The FYIP program offers a time-saving advantage by combining the two degrees into a single five-year program, whereas the traditional route typically takes six years. This can be a crucial factor for students who are eager to enter the workforce or pursue further research sooner. The integrated curriculum of the FYIP program allows for a more seamless transition from undergraduate to postgraduate studies, enabling students to delve deeper into their chosen specialization. In contrast, the traditional route may involve a break in studies between the B.Tech and M.Tech programs, potentially disrupting the learning flow. Another factor to consider is the cost of education. The FYIP program may offer financial benefits by saving a year of tuition and living expenses. However, the fees for integrated programs can sometimes be higher than those for individual degrees. It is essential to compare the total cost of education for both options.
